GHCA's Robotics Class - Sentry Bot
Sentrybot was designed to be some what like a security system for our school. Its original design was sort of like a guard dog, in a sense. It will hopefully patrol the halls of the school. It was originally going to have just one platform but since then is has evolved into 2 platforms with the possibility of a third platform. Home The robot consists of a motherboard salvaged from a old computer, a 12 volt car battery, lawnmower wheels, plywood, windshield motors, a DC-AC converter, two optical USB mice, a USB hub, a hard drive from the same computer mentioned before, etc. There is also a USB card a Network adaptor, a sonar system, a home made circuit board(pictures available), a bike sprocket, a modified bike chain, wires, and a few erector pieces for grounding. The on-board computer, which runs Linux, and homemade circuit board serve the purpose of controling the drive and steering motors, as well as any future devices. The steering motor turns the front wheel, which is also the drive wheel. The two mice and the mice pads are mounted on the back two wheels to provide direction feedback. We will eventually interface the sonar and also add bump sensors so the robot can sense its environment. See our blog for the latest details about our progress with this robot.
